Very Strong
Potassium
Fluid balance and electrolyte support
Adequate Intake is 2,600 mg/day for women and 3,400 mg/day for men. US supplements are capped at 99 mg per serving, so a pill cannot match what was studied; food is the realistic route.

Very Strong
Glucose / Dextrose
Accelerated fluid absorption via SGLT1 cotransport
Oral rehydration solution 13.5 g glucose/L; sports 40-80 g/L (4-8%); endurance 30-60 g/hr (90 g/hr glucose+fructose 2:1); post-exercise 1.0-1.2 g/kg plus protein.
